| Element | Carbon (C) | Manganese (Mn) | Phosphorus (P) | Sulfur (S) | Silicon (Si) | Chromium (Cr) | Nickel (Ni) | Nitrogen (N) |
| Percentage | 0.035 max | 2.00 max | 0.045 max | 0.030 max | 1.00 max | 18.0 - 20.0 | 8.0 - 12.0 | 0.10 max |
| Property | Metric Value | Imperial Value |
| Tensile Strength (min) | 485 MPa | 70,000 psi |
| Yield Strength (0.2% Offset) | 170 MPa | 25,000 psi |
| Elongation (in 50mm) | 35% min | 35% min |
| Hardness (Brinell) | 201 HBW max | � |
| Hardness (Rockwell B) | 92 HRB max | � |
| Property | Value |
| Density | 8,000 kg/m� (0.285 lb/in�) |
| Melting Point Range | 1400-1450�C (2550-2650�F) |
| Modulus of Elasticity | 193 GPa (28.0 x 106 psi) |
| Thermal Conductivity | 16.2 W/m-K (at 100�C) |
| Electrical Resistivity | 720 nO�m |
| Specific Heat | 500 J/kg-K (0-100�C) |
| Magnetic Permeability | 1.02 (Annealed condition) |

| USA (ASTM) | European (EN) | German (DIN) | Japanese (JIS) | British (BS) | UNS Designation |
| TP304 | 1.4301 | X5CrNi18-10 | SUS 304 | 304S31 | S30400 |
| TP304L | 1.4307 | X2CrNi18-9 | SUS 304L | 304S11 | S30403 |
| TP304H | 1.4948 | X6CrNi18-11 | SUS 304H | 304S51 | S30409 |

The SS 304L is made up of 18�20% chromium, 8�13% nickel, =0.03% carbon, with small amounts of manganese, silicon, phosphorus, and sulfur.
The 304L has lower carbon content, making it better for welding and reducing carbide precipitation, while 304 is stronger at higher temperatures.
The Prices of the SS 304L seamless pipe vary by size, schedule, and quantity, but it is generally slightly higher than SS 304 due to its low-carbon specification.
SS 304L is highly corrosion-resistant, but it may rust in harsh chloride or acidic environments without proper care.
Yes, it performs well in moderate to high temperatures and high-pressure applications, making it ideal for chemical, petrochemical, and oil & gas industries.
